Village Green Early Learning Centre

We were delighted to partner with biophilic designer Jade Hurst, founder and designer of Good_Space, to bring nature-led design into the heart of Village Green Early Learning Centre. This collaboration reflects our shared belief that the spaces where children learn and grow should be immersed in the natural world, nurturing curiosity, creativity, and wellbeing from the very beginning.

Creating environments that support our youngest generation is an investment in the future. By working with like-minded people who share a commitment to sustainability, we can ensure that these spaces are not only beautiful and functional, but also encourage a deep connection with the environment.

For Village Green, every detail was considered through the lens of biophilic design, from the greenery that softens the architecture, to the textures, tones, and planting schemes that invite children to explore and engage with nature. The result is a space that feels alive, restorative, and inspiring for both the children and the educators who guide them.
